About IV Sedation for Mount Pleasant Patients

IV sedation uses medication given through a small line in the arm to bring on a calm, drowsy state within minutes. For Mount Pleasant patients, it is often the answer to obstacles that go beyond nerves: a powerful gag reflex, difficulty getting numb, or a long-avoided mouthful of work that is simply too much to face awake.

Sedation at this level belongs with a specialist, so a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ist manages and monitors yours from the first moment to the last, tracking your airway and vital signs while the dentist concentrates on treatment. Because he reviews your history ahead of time, he can tailor the sedation to your age, weight, and any conditions you manage. He works between our Longview and Tyler offices, so Mount Pleasant visits are set for his Longview days.

Your first appointment is a consultation covering your health, your medications, and what you want done, including anything past dentists could not complete because of your gag reflex or anxiety. We provide written pre-op instructions and arrange for a driver to take you the 50 minutes back up US-271 to Titus County.
